PCB Design Process

PCB (Printed Circuit Board) is a circuit board that is an important part of the electronic system. A PCB is a board that connects each electrical component so that it can connect to each other and can work for a particular process. Pcb process is carried out in several systematic stages, each process must be done properly and thoroughly so as not to cause damage or errors that can interfere with the performance of each electronic component on the PCB. The first stage in pcb manufacturing is the PCB design stage. This design stage consists of several interconnected sets of activities. 


The following are common stages in the Printed Circuit Board (PCB) design process. 

 

Printed Circuit Board (PCB)

Creating Circuit Design

The early stage of PCB design is to create a circuit design. The circuit design process is done by paying attention to the components that will be applied in the PCB. The PCB design process can be done by looking at various references that will be useful to give an idea of the design of the circuit to be created.
The process of creating circuit design can be done by utilizing PCB schematic applications such as Development System Microcontroller ATMega8535 or other schematics. In the process of creating circuit design make sure to create a unique signator for the laying of each component such as C1, A1, B1, and so on so as to facilitate the placement and routing process in PCB documents.  

Checking Component Availability

The next step in the PCB design process is to check the availability of components. In this process a list of components is performed or commonly called the Bill of Material (BOM). Once a complete list of components is created the next step is to find the necessary components in order for the assembly to build the assembled PCB. 

The process of searching pcb components can be done online or offline. If possible offline then make sure the required stock can meet the required number of components. If pcb components are not available then can search for those PCB components online with the worldwide market so that it can meet the needs of components especially if you want to print PCBs on a large scale.

Testing Suite Functionality

The process of testing the functionality of the suite is done to ensure that the designed suite can work properly. This testing process is carried out using many tools according to the type of PCB built. Some types of tools used in pcb manufacturing include multimeter, led indicator, lcd and others. The testing process is done using various prototypes so that the testing can be described in real time. 

Schematic Footprint Verification

At the final stage in schematic creation is verifying the size of the footprint designed already according to the one described in the schematic document. BOM documents can be used as a reference to verify the footprint needed.

Such is the general process carried out in the PCB design process. Hopefully it can be useful in understanding the basic PCB design process.
